American MD Program students received certificates of participation for the essay contest “Biomarkers in the diagnosis of rare diseases”

Comment (0) Share (0)

Ajay Pranay Shah, Mariam Chelidze, Ani Chagiashvili, Zakee Azmi, Daniel Pak, American MD Program students of Tbilisi State Medical University received certificates of participation for the essay contest “Biomarkers in the diagnosis of rare diseases”.

Department of Molecular and Medical Genetics and Georgian Society of Medical Genetics and Epigenetics held conference, dedicated to the International Rare Disease Day, which were held on February 28 at the TSMU administrative building rector’s hall.

The conference covered current issues related to rare diseases, including necessity and availability of diagnosis and treatment, current research projects and clinical studies. Within the frames of the conference the winner of the students’ essay contest: “Biomarkers in the diagnosis of rare diseases” were announced. he contest winner received full scholarship from CENTOGENE AG to attend the disease conference – Recent Advances in Rare Diseases (RARD) in Bogota (Columbia) on June 20-22, 2019.
